The wildest product we saw at CES is finally on sale, and we project good things

Share
Share


  • Aurzen first debuted its tri-folding compact projector at CES 2025
  • After a Kickstarter, it’s now up for sale on Amazon and already seeing a discount
  • With the ultra-portable Zip projector, it can show content horizontally or vertically

The 2025 Consumer Electronics Show might be long over, but in about four months since then, one of the wildest products we saw on the show floor is well up for order and shipping soon.

The Aurzen ZIP is a tri-folding ultra-portable projector, making the like of the Samsung Freestyle seem downright clunky. It impressed us in a brief demonstration at the show, mostly for the sheer novelty and it’s up for order right now on Amazon.
